We are looking for a Supply Planner to strengthen our Supply Chain Operations team. Every week, the team purchases all the ingredients for our HelloFresh boxes and manages supplier performance and quality.
As a Supply Chain Planner, you will independently manage our ordering process: delivery scheduling, shortage management, supplier performance improvement, and more.
Reducing food waste, OTIFIQ (On Time, In Full, In Quality), and error rates are your key daily performance indicators!
